Notchchainfx.com

Investment scams
https://notchchainfx.com

Notchchainfx.com tricks people with a fake investment scheme. The site just started, being only 80 days old. It shows fake reviews from people who don’t exist. They promise big profits, but once you invest, they take your money and vanish. The company doesn’t have a presence on social media. There’s no customer service phone number on the website.

Investment scams promise high returns with little risk, but they take your money and disappear, leaving you with nothing.

An investment scam is a deceptive scheme where fraudsters promise high returns with little risk. Scammers often lure individuals by presenting themselves as financial experts or using fake credentials. They create a sense of urgency, pressuring targets to invest quickly. Promises of guaranteed returns or no-risk investments are common. Scammers use complex jargon to confuse and impress potential victims. They may also show fake testimonials or endorsements to build credibility. Some even create fake websites or documents to appear legitimate. Communication is often through unsolicited calls, emails, or social media messages. Scammers target emotions, exploiting greed or fear of missing out. Once they receive the money, they disappear without a trace, leaving victims with significant financial losses.
